Ayudar Services Llc - Medicare Mental Health Clinic in Corrales, NM

Ayudar Services Llc is a medicare enrolled mental health clinic (Social Worker - Clinical) in Corrales, New Mexico. The current practice location for Ayudar Services Llc is 245 Camino Sin Pasada, Corrales, New Mexico. For appointments, you can reach them via phone at (505) 553-2969. The mailing address for Ayudar Services Llc is Po Box 2239, Corrales, New Mexico and phone number is (505) 553-2969.

Ayudar Services Llc is licensed to practice in New Mexico (license number I-05875). The clinic also participates in the medicare program and its NPI number is 1770899817. This medical practice accepts medicare insurance (which means this clinic accepts the Medicare-approved amount; you will not be billed for any more than the Medicare deductible and coinsurance). However, please confirm if they accept your insurance at (505) 553-2969.

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Ayudar Services Llc acts as a billing entity for following providers:
